The FEDERAL REGISTER provides a uniform system for making available
to the public regulations and legal notices issued by Federal
agencies. These include Presidential proclamations and Executive
Orders, Federal agency documents having general applicability and
legal effect, documents required to be published by act of Congress,
and other Federal agency documents of public interest.
Documents are on file for public inspection in the Office of the
Federal Register the day before they are published, unless the issuing
agency requests earlier filing. For a list of documents currently on
file for public inspection, see www.archives.gov.
The seal of the National Archives and Records Administration
authenticates the Federal Register as the official serial publication
established under the Federal Register Act. Under 44 U.S.C. 1507, the
contents of the Federal Register shall be judicially noticed.
